Funzioni di sistema (Transact-SQL)

Le funzioni riportate di seguito eseguono operazioni e restituiscono informazioni su valori, oggetti e impostazioni in SQL Server 2005.

Nella tabella seguente sono riportate le funzioni di sistema Transact-SQL e viene indicato se sono deterministiche o meno. Per ulteriori informazioni sulle funzioni deterministiche, vedere Funzioni deterministiche e non deterministiche.

Funzione Determinismo

APP_NAME

Non deterministica

Espressione CASE

Deterministica

CAST e CONVERT

Deterministiche a meno che non vengano utilizzate con il tipo di dati datetime, smalldatetime o sql_variant.

COALESCE

Deterministica

COLLATIONPROPERTY

Non deterministica

COLUMNS_UPDATED

Non deterministica

CURRENT_TIMESTAMP

Non deterministica

CURRENT_USER

Non deterministica

DATALENGTH

Deterministica

@@ERROR

Non deterministica

ERROR_LINE

Non deterministica

ERROR_MESSAGE

Non deterministica

ERROR_NUMBER

Non deterministica

ERROR_PROCEDURE

Non deterministica

ERROR_SEVERITY

Non deterministica

ERROR_STATE (Transact-SQL)

Non deterministica

fn_helpcollations

Deterministica

fn_servershareddrives

Non deterministica

fn_virtualfilestats

Non deterministica

FORMATMESSAGE

Non deterministica

GETANSINULL

Non deterministica

HOST_ID

Non deterministica

HOST_NAME

Non deterministica

IDENT_CURRENT

Non deterministica

IDENT_INCR

Non deterministica

IDENT_SEED

Non deterministica

@@IDENTITY

Non deterministica

IDENTITY (funzione)

Non deterministica

ISDATE

Non deterministica

ISNULL

Deterministica

ISNUMERIC

Deterministica

NEWID

Non deterministica

NULLIF

Deterministica

PARSENAME

Deterministica

ORIGINAL_LOGIN

Non deterministica

@@ROWCOUNT

Non deterministica

ROWCOUNT_BIG

Non deterministica

SCOPE_IDENTITY

Non deterministica

SERVERPROPERTY

Non deterministica

SESSIONPROPERTY

Non deterministica

SESSION_USER

Non deterministica

STATS_DATE

Non deterministica

sys.dm_db_index_physical_stats

Non deterministica

SYSTEM_USER

Non deterministica

@@TRANCOUNT

Non deterministica

UPDATE()

Non deterministica

USER_NAME

Non deterministica

XACT_STATE

Non deterministica

Vedere anche

Riferimento

Funzioni (Transact-SQL)

Guida in linea e informazioni

Assistenza su SQL Server 2005